Conservative Achievement 2010 to 2024

Delivered Brexit. 

We delivered on the historic mandate of the British people to leave the European Union, ending decades of control by Brussels bureaucrats and restoring sovereignty to Parliament.

Reformed education to give the next generation the best start in life. 

Through our academy and education reforms, by 2023 the number of schools rated good or outstanding in England had risen from 68 per cent under Labour to 90 per cent, with children rated the best readers in the western world.

Delivered 2.5 million more homes, including one million homes in the last Parliament. 

In office, we delivered over 2.5 million additional homes and met our target to deliver one million homes over the last Parliament, while protecting the green belt by prioritising the building of new homes on brownfield land.

Got 4 million more people into work whilst reforming and strengthening our welfare system to deliver fairness. 

When we left office, there were over 4 million more people in work, the unemployment rate was near record lows and the employment rate 4.3 percentage points higher compared to 2010. We reformed welfare by introducing Universal Credit so people were moved off benefits and into work and we capped benefits by introducing the two child-limit.

Created the new NATO benchmark of 2.5 per cent and set Britain on the pathway of spending 2.5 per cent of GDP on defence by 2030. 

We planned to maintain our leading position in NATO with defence spending reaching 2.5 per cent of GDP by 2030, primarily focused on three areas: firing up the UK defence industrial base, modernising our Armed Forces, and backing Ukraine’s defence. This would have made us the second largest NATO contributor, after the United States.

Launched the first Long-Term Workforce Plan in the NHS’s history, fostering homegrown talent across our health service. 

The NHS Long-Term Workforce Plan was the first in the NHS’s history ensuring we foster homegrown talent, especially in areas where it is needed most.

Put over 20,000 extra police officers on our streets and more than halved crime since 2010. 

We exceeded our target by recruiting over 20,000 more police officers, with more officers than in 2010 to keep our communities safe. This has helped us cut neighbourhood crime by 54 per cent during our time in office.

Created the conditions for 1.1 million more businesses to open since 2010 and introduced the biggest ever tax cut for business. 

In 2010, there were 4.5 million businesses and there were 5.6 million when we left office – an increase of a quarter. The super-deduction was the biggest single business tax cut in modern British history.

Secured trade deals with 73 countries plus one with the EU, creating new opportunities for British businesses to help grow the economy. 

Joining the CPTPP delivered two new trade deals with Malaysia and Brunei, meaning the UK has trade deals with 73 countries, plus the EU, that accounted for £1.1 trillion of UK bilateral trade in 2022.
